M22-2012205 Equivalent & Substitute Parts
Part Overview
The M22-2012205 is a rectangular connector header manufactured by Harwin Inc., featuring 22 positions at 2.00mm pitch for through-hole board-to-board applications. This connector is classified as obsolete, necessitating identification of active equivalent and substitute parts for ongoing design requirements and procurement needs. The part operates across the industrial temperature range of -55°C to 105°C with gold-plated mating contacts and phosphor bronze construction.

Substitute Part Grouping Explanation
Substitution of the M22-2012205 is determined by the following critical parameters:
Primary Compatibility Criteria:
- Number of positions: 22 positions (exact match required for pin count compatibility)
- Pitch - Mating: 0.079" (2.00mm) (mandatory for connector interface compatibility)
- Connector type: Header, cuttable (functional requirement for board-to-board applications)
- Contact type: Male pin (electrical interface requirement)
- Mounting type: Through hole (PCB assembly method)
- Termination: Solder (assembly process compatibility)
Secondary Compatibility Considerations:
- Contact length parameters (mating and post) determine physical fit and stacking height compatibility
- Insulation material affects mechanical durability and environmental resistance
- Contact finish (gold vs. tin) influences corrosion resistance and signal integrity
- Current rating must meet or exceed application requirements
- Operating temperature range must encompass application environment
- Compliance certifications (RoHS, UL94) must satisfy regulatory requirements
The M22-2012305 (23-position variant) does not qualify as a direct substitute due to position count mismatch. Samtec MTMM-122 series parts maintain the critical 22-position, 2.00mm pitch configuration and are therefore valid substitutes when contact length and temperature specifications align with application requirements.

Engineering Selection Recommendations
Direct Harwin Equivalent: M22-2012305 maintains identical electrical and mechanical specifications to the M22-2012205 with the exception of position count (23 vs. 22). This part is active and ROHS3 compliant but is not a pin-compatible substitute due to the additional position.
Samtec MTMM-122 Series Substitutes: All listed Samtec MTMM-122 series connectors maintain the critical 22-position, 2.00mm pitch configuration required for direct substitution. These parts are active products with ROHS3 compliance and UL94 V-0 flammability ratings. Selection among variants depends on contact length requirements:
- MTMM-122-04-T-S-138 provides the closest match to M22-2012205 contact length specifications (0.138" mating contact) and maintains the -55°C to 105°C operating temperature range.
- MTMM-122-02-F-S-125, MTMM-122-02-G-S-105, and MTMM-122-02-G-S-115 feature shorter contact lengths suitable for applications with reduced stacking height requirements.
- MTMM-122-04-F-S-142 and MTMM-122-04-L-S-142 provide extended contact lengths for applications requiring greater mating depth.
- MTMM-122-06-F-S-150 and MTMM-122-10-series parts offer progressively longer post lengths for applications requiring extended through-hole penetration.
All Samtec substitutes provide enhanced current rating (3A vs. 1A) and extended operating temperature range (-55°C to 125°C), representing performance improvements over the obsolete M22-2012205.
Frequently Asked Questions (FAQ)
Q: Can M22-2012305 be used as a direct replacement for M22-2012205? A: No. While M22-2012305 shares identical electrical and mechanical specifications, it contains 23 positions versus 22 positions in the M22-2012205. This position mismatch prevents pin-for-pin compatibility and requires PCB redesign for implementation.
Q: What is the primary difference between Harwin M22 and Samtec MTMM-122 series connectors? A: Both maintain the 22-position, 2.00mm pitch configuration required for substitution. Primary differences include insulation material (Polyamide vs. Liquid Crystal Polymer), current rating (1A vs. 3A), and operating temperature range (-55°C to 105°C vs. -55°C to 125°C). Samtec parts offer enhanced electrical performance and thermal capability.
Q: How do contact length variations affect connector selection? A: Contact length determines mating depth and stacking height when connectors are mated. The M22-2012205 specifies 0.138" mating contact length. MTMM-122-04-T-S-138 provides identical mating contact length. Shorter variants (MTMM-122-02 series) reduce overall stacking height; longer variants (MTMM-122-06 and MTMM-122-10 series) increase post length for deeper PCB penetration.
Q: Are all listed substitutes RoHS3 compliant? A: Yes. All substitute parts listed maintain ROHS3 compliance and UL94 V-0 flammability rating, satisfying regulatory requirements equivalent to the M22-2012205.
Q: What is the significance of contact finish differences (Gold vs. Tin)? A: Gold-plated mating contacts provide superior corrosion resistance and signal integrity in high-reliability applications. Tin-plated contacts (MTMM-122-04-T-S-138) offer cost optimization while maintaining adequate performance for standard industrial applications. Contact finish selection depends on environmental exposure and signal quality requirements.
Q: Can MTMM-122 series connectors accommodate the same mating interface as M22-2012205? A: Yes. All MTMM-122 variants maintain the 2.00mm pitch and 22-position configuration, ensuring mechanical and electrical compatibility with existing mating connectors designed for M22-2012205.
